Choice of grooving tools for high boron steel, high speed steel, and infinitely chilled cast iron rolls


High-boron steel, high-speed steel, and infinitely chilled cast iron rolls are widely used in the forming of wire rods, bars, and profiles. The roll pass has a great impact on the quality of finished products, mill productivity, equipment safety, and production costs. Therefore, in the machining process, the production requirements are also very high, so be careful when turning high-boron steel, high-speed steel, and infinite chilled cast iron roll grooves.

High-boron steel roll: high hardness, the value is HS75-80, ordinary roll machine tools and processing tools are not competent, ordinary pipe rolling machine tools are not rigid enough, the knife resistance is large during machining, and the vibration is severe, which affects the processing accuracy of the roll and the machine tool At the same time, processing high-boron steel rolls with general-purpose cutting tools will rapidly increase the wear of the cutting edge and flank, and the tool will be sharply passivated, making it impossible to process stably.

 

High-speed steel roll: the hardness is as high as HSD85-92, and it has good thermal stability. Intermittent cutting is more difficult to process, so choosing a reasonable processing tool and cutting amount is a prerequisite for determining whether the high-speed steel roll can be used normally on an online bar mill.

 

Infinite chilled cast iron roll: its surface is a white layer, but there is no obvious boundary between the white layer and the gray layer, and the hardness of the roll surface is HS ≥ 65. Because it is cast, there are especially large infinite chilled cast iron rolls on the rough edge surface. Casting defects, common cutting tools wear out sharply and cannot be processed stably.

 

In view of the performance of the above-mentioned high-boron steel, high-speed steel, and infinitely chilled cast iron rolls, three PCBN cutters are recommended for the groove process, namely BN-K1 grade, BN-S20 grade, and BN-S300 grade. When the groove surface quality of the roll is good If the machining surface has defects such as cracks and falling blocks, choose the BN-S20 grade. If the working conditions are harsh, choose the BN-K1 grade under strong intermittent cutting.

1. Case of high boron steel roll grooving

Halnn solutions of high boron steel roll grooving

Processing material: high boron steel

Roll hardness: HRC68

Insert grade: BN-S20 RCMX-V series

Tool durability: 24 slots/cutting edge

 

2. Case of high-speed steel roll grooving

 

(1) Case of repaired rebar groove

Halnn solutions of repaired rebar groove

Processing material: high speed steel; hardness: HRC64

Insert grade: BN-S300

Cutting parameters: Vc=40m/min, ap=0.5mm, f=0.5mm/r

Processing effect: the efficiency is 5 times that of carbide tools, and its durability is 4 times.

 

(2) Case of the repaired wire roll groove

Halnn solutions of the repaired wire roll groove

Processing material: high speed steel roll, hardness: HRC63

Insert grade: BN-S300

Cutting parameters: Vc=26m/min, ap=2mm, f=0.5mm/r

Tool durability: 60min

 

3. Case of infinite chilled cast iron roll groove

Halnn solutions of infinite chilled cast iron roll groove

Processing material: alloy infinite chilled cast iron

Roll hardness: HSD68

Insert grade: BN-K1

Cutting parameters: Vc=80m/min, ap=0.5mm, f=0.3mm/r

Processing effect: The efficiency of BN-K1 is 2 times higher than that of other brands carbide tools, and its durability is 7 times.
